Also not only by politicians, who were elected for decision making. We all decide. It does not matter where we are or when a decision is needed. The necessity to make a selection exists, without being aware of it. And sometimes it becomes visible by being torn one way or the other that puts you into a state of shock. Some people may sit out decisions and let themselves be driven with the hope to escape the obligation to decide. If you sit out decisions and leave yourself to this way, you are advancing constantly, sometimes the direction is even changing, but you do not exploit your possibilities. There are always at least three options to change the walkway. Many succumb to the illusion that they do not make a decision, if they simply do not move. However, they forget thereby that this is also a decision. &#8211; the decision to leave yourself to your fate. How do you leave this way and take over control?<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Decision-making pressure<br \/>\n<\/strong>When you do not like something or new possibilities emerge, which seem to be better than the current, the need for a decision arises. These signals are an important condition for conscious decision making. They are often private or business problems. Additionally, there are again and again opportunities that provide new development potentials.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Make options clear<br \/>\n<\/strong>You should be clear about the options after you recognize them. It is not only about the alternatives that you have, but also about being able to find further alternatives. Besides new tasks that open up, there are always further approaches that you were not aware yet.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Think about consequences<br \/>\n<\/strong>The consequences that result from the different opportunities, should be reflected. You should become aware of the advantages of each alternative. Additionally, you should not forget the disadvantages that result. Additionally, you should make yourself clear about the things that you give up, if you leave the current way. Perhaps the loss maybe higher. In this case you know what you have to do.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Decide<br \/>\n<\/strong>As soon as it is clear, what you want, it is important to make your choice. And not only making the decision but also to act immediately. With the preparation it is clear, what you should do and what areas need special care.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Staying attentive<br \/>\n<\/strong>Since you are moving on new ground, it is an advantage to make each step attentively. Surprises are waiting on the new way that you do not expect. With the momentum of active decision, you should be prepared for additional efforts. It is important to find new options and to decide, if you get to the point that you set on the wrong horse and the decision pressure already becomes noticeable.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Bottom line: We make decisions without interruptions and not only, when we are consciously in a decision making case. Even if we think that we are able to avoid the resolution by simply doing nothing, we make a decision, i.e. the decision for whatever the result will be without our control. You should use your chances, by actively deciding and not leaving your own fate to somebody else. Additionally being decisive differently is mostly better.
